Somali army takes key city in Southwest after state leader resigns
actor1: Somalia Federal Government Forces -> actor2: Southwest State authorities
On 2026-04-01, Somalia鈥檚 federal forces entered and took full control of Baidoa, the largest city in Southwest state. The move came as regional leader Abdiaziz Hassan Mohamed Laftagareen resigned and the federal government appointed an acting president. The article describes the takeover as marking the start of a political transition, with no fatalities reported.
